If you are using AB to check FPS, I don't think AB works with CrossfireX.

At least when I had my Crossfired 5870s (up until September) AB didn't work with Crossfire, so you maay be getting bad data.
 
Try completely uninstalling your drivers and reinstalling. I have run into issues in the pass by not doing a fresh install of the ATI drivers. May fix your prob, hopefully this helps.

Yes, good idea. Sometimes the driver fails to recognize the second card if it was installed after the primary card.

What driver version are you using? make sure you have the most recent Crossfire Application Profiles loaded, you can use the newest profiles with an older driver if you want to.

Did you look at Afterburner to see if the second card was being utilized at all in your games? Unfortunately, Crossfire scaling is just not there in some games
